5 Types of Evidence Needed to Convict Someone of Drug Crimes

The prosecutor in your case could use several types of evidence to try and convict you. Our knowledgeable lawyers understand the types of evidence they may present and help you feel prepared and informed throughout your case. Some common types of evidence used to convict someone of a drug crime include the following:

Expert Testimony

Prosecutors often use drug experts like crime lab workers to verify the found substance as one listed in the Controlled Substance Act. These experts can provide chemical test results that may prove this to be true.

The Found Substance

The controlled substance itself may be brought into the courtroom as evidence. This can prove the drug exists and show the jury how much was found.

Video Footage

In some cases, there may be video footage that proves possession of a controlled substance. Video evidence may also play a role in proving larger operations with intentions to distribute.

Officer Testimony

Drug crime cases often center around officer testimony because they administer the charges. If a police officer stops someone at a traffic stop or has grounds to pull someone over and search their vehicle, their testimony is a major part of proving the validity of these charges.

Witness Testimony

Drug crime cases often involve witnesses, so prosecutors may interview anyone else involved in your case. This may include people who watched you purchase, transport, or use the controlled substance or anyone present during your arrest.
